... on Inauguration Day. That confirmation came in an affidavit filed today by Roberts' court counselor in a pending lawsuit by an atheist opposed to any mention of God in the inaugural ceremonies. Roberts said he would abide by Obamas wishes. The Constitution has specific language on what has to be said when swearing in the president, but the so help me God phrase has traditionally been added at the end of the required oath, starting with George Washington in 1789.
